I am currently heading up the efforts within my company to purchase a computational fluid dynamics analysis software. I was wondering if anyone out within the HVAC industry has had the opportunity to work with this software and which software they feel are best suited for HVAC applications? I have spent the last month researching software and narrowed my decision down to a few, Fluent, Ansys CFX, or Star-CCM+. I also found a couple other software packages out there specific to HVAC such as Ansys Air Pak and Flovent, but felt that their capabilities were limited to specific problems. If anyone else has experience with CFD analysis specific to HVAC please let me know what you are using and your opinion of it. Also, what kind of learning curve was involved with getting to know the "code"?

The only people I know dealing with CFD in HVAC are those that work sepcifically in tunnel ventilation, modeling smoke control, tunnel temperature, etc.. to eastablish refuge location, tunnel height, etc.
Could be applicable if you deal with penitentiary design on a regular basis. Even with that, lack of true codes (IBC 2006 dumps all smoke control responsibility on the designer).
In regular building HVAC, I don't see a true market for it that would justify the cost of such a thing. I'd invest in energy medeling software instead these days instead of CFD.

You might be interested in TAS. It has 3 components: thermal simulation, HVAC and CFD analysis.
Besides extensive mechanical/electrical package, HEVACOMP also incorporates CFD component for temperature and air velocity distribution. Total price is cca. 5000 British Pounds.
Here is my 2 cents.... What CFD to select depends upon the level of details you are interested to achieve e.g while FLUENT would be suitable for research purposes and requires strong background, Hevacomp would be more suitable for practical calculations.
